The Lowes 10% off did not work on my Delta Business card - on the language it says excludes "corporate gift cards" - so that must have been why the Netflix gift cards did not work. On another recent occasion when Lowes was doing another Amex offer -it worked on one my cards but did not work on a business Amex (one card was my husband's). There must be something blocking gift cards on the business cards with Lowes. I've never had an issue with buying gift cards at Staples on any card.

Hilton brand hotels in Hawaii - spend $1000+ on room rate and room charges, get $200 back. For stays 2/10 through 6/30.
Offer does not apply to advance purchase rates, including Advance Purchase, Save Now & Pay and Non-refundable rates. Excludes gift card purchases. |
